How much do foreclosure legal assistant jobs pay per year?
As of Sep 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for foreclosure legal assistant in the United States is $48,215.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,000.00 and $55,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.
A Foreclosure Legal Assistant supports attorneys and legal teams in handling foreclosure cases. Their duties typically include preparing and filing legal documents, managing case files, communicating with clients and courts, and tracking deadlines related to foreclosure proceedings. They help ensure that all necessary paperwork is completed accurately and on time, and they may also assist in researching property records or coordinating with other parties involved in the foreclosure process.
A Foreclosure Legal Assistant works closely with attorneys by preparing and reviewing legal documents, scheduling hearings, and ensuring deadlines are met throughout each phase of the foreclosure process. They often coordinate with paralegals, title companies, and court personnel to gather and verify required information. Regular communication and teamwork are essential, as legal assistants must keep attorneys informed of case progress and respond swiftly to any changes or issues that arise. This collaborative environment helps ensure that all legal procedures are followed accurately and efficiently.
To thrive as a Foreclosure Legal Assistant, you need a solid understanding of legal procedures, strong organizational skills, and experience with foreclosure documentation, often supported by a paralegal certificate or relevant legal experience. Familiarity with case management software, e-filing systems, and Microsoft Office Suite is typically required. Attention to detail, strong communication, and the ability to manage deadlines under pressure are vital soft skills in this role. These skills ensure accuracy, efficiency, and compliance in handling sensitive foreclosure cases within strict legal timelines.
